Description

The band standing straight arm pulldown anchors a resistance band overhead and pulls the band handles down to the hips with straight arms. The straight-arm setup eliminates biceps involvement and isolates the lats hard. It is a great home version of the cable straight arm pulldown.

Band Standing Straight Arm Pulldown Instructions

  1. Anchor a resistance band overhead.
  2. Stand facing the anchor with feet shoulder-width apart.
  3. Grab a handle in each hand with arms extended overhead.
  4. Step back slightly to add tension.
  5. Brace your core and keep your chest up.
  6. Keep your arms straight throughout the entire movement.
  7. Pull the handles down to your thighs by driving them down with the lats.
  8. Squeeze the lats hard at the bottom, then return slowly.

Band Standing Straight Arm Pulldown Muscles Worked

  • Latissimus dorsi
  • Triceps (long head)
  • Teres major
